Timeless Tuxedo Magic

The Classic Black Tuxedo

When it comes to timeless and elegant, the black tuxedo reigns supreme. This sartorial staple exudes sophistication and formality, making it an ideal choice for traditional weddings. Pair it with a crisp white dress shirt, a tailored waistcoat, and patent leather shoes for an unforgettable look.

Midnight Blue for a Dash of Style

For a subtle twist on the classic tuxedo, consider opting for a midnight blue hue. This rich color adds depth and dimension to your outfit without compromising on its formal appeal. Accessorize with a silver or platinum tie and pocket square to complement the midnight blue’s regal charm.

Suited for Success

Modern Grey Suit for a Contemporary Edge

Step into the realm of contemporary elegance with a tailored grey suit. This versatile piece allows for endless customization, from light charcoal to steel blue. Pair it with a crisp white shirt, a patterned tie, and polished brown shoes for a modern and sophisticated look.

If you’re planning a seaside or coastal wedding, a navy suit is an exquisite choice. Its nautical charm will pay homage to the occasion, while its versatility will ensure you look sharp and stylish. Opt for a classic double-breasted style or a sleek single-breasted option, and accessorize with a crisp white shirt, a navy tie, and boat shoes for a perfect finishing touch.

Unconventional Elegance

Boho Chic for a Rustic Wedding

Embrace the earthy charm of a rustic wedding with a boho-chic outfit idea. Pair a tailored waistcoat in a neutral color with linen pants and a flowing open-necked shirt. Accessorize with a floral tie, a fedora, and rustic accessories to complete your bohemian look.

Casual Cool for an Intimate Ceremony

If you prefer a more relaxed and intimate wedding, consider opting for a casual-chic outfit. A navy blazer paired with chinos, a chambray shirt, and loafers will exude effortless style without compromising on comfort. Roll up your sleeves and unbutton your collar for a touch of casual charm.

FAQ about Outfit Ideas for Groom

1. What is the traditional groom’s attire?

A tuxedo is the traditional choice for a groom’s outfit. It typically consists of a black or midnight blue jacket with matching pants, a white dress shirt, a black bow tie, and black dress shoes.

2. Are there any alternatives to a tuxedo?

Yes, there are several alternatives to a tuxedo for grooms. Some popular options include a suit, a sport coat and dress pants, or a more casual outfit such as a button-down shirt and chinos.

3. What should the groom consider when choosing his outfit?

The groom should consider the formality of the wedding, the time of year, and his personal style when choosing his outfit. He should also make sure that his outfit complements the bride’s dress.

4. What accessories can the groom add to his outfit?

The groom can add several accessories to his outfit, such as a pocket square, a tie bar, a boutonniere, and cufflinks. These accessories can help to personalize the groom’s look and make him stand out on his wedding day.

5. What are some tips for choosing the right outfit for the groom?

Here are some tips for choosing the right outfit for the groom:

  • Consider the formality of the wedding.
  • Choose an outfit that complements the bride’s dress.
  • Make sure the outfit is comfortable and allows the groom to move freely.
  • Get the outfit tailored to fit properly.
  • Accessorize the outfit with personal touches.
